15-year-old Ran Kenelm can fix anything! He can talk smart machines into repairing themselves. Faced with conquering his phobia for virtual reality before he can continue in school, Ran opts to escape foster care and find a job. But no one will hire him.
Hallie Pollard's rush to finish school gets sidetracked when she witnesses a bombing and, against orders, investigates its cause.
Pel Teague bikes to Dodge, on the trail of unexplained disappearances. Unbelievable disappearances. In an age when everyone is chipped and accounted for, how can people just disappear? Then he gets a chance to pose a question to the national computer.
A fateful picnic results in an attempted kidnapping of Hallie. Ran's rescue leaves him severely burned, Hallie is in the hospital with a loss of memory, and Pel locked up as complicit in the deaths of two kidnappers.
All three are ordered aboard a starship, destination unknown. When Pel discovers several orphans are also aboard, being returned to their parents, Pel is sure it's because of his question.
While the others undergo space sleep, Ran, still healing from burns, finally confronts his VR phobia. But there are saboteurs who don't want the ship to arrive.
